Crime in LS20: Crime Rate & Statistics 2026

LS20 recorded 76 crimes in April 2026 — a crime rate of 3.13 per 1,000 residents. Violence & Sexual Offences accounts for the largest share of crime at 46.1% of all offences recorded. Crime is down 29.0% compared to the same period last year.

Crime Analysis: LS20

Violence & Sexual Offences accounts for more than a third of all recorded crime in LS20 (46.1%). Anti-social Behaviour (10.5%) and Criminal Damage & Arson (10.5%) are the next most common categories.

Compared to the same period last year, crime in LS20 has fallen sharply — by 29.0%. The 12-month trend chart above shows where this change is concentrated across individual offence categories.

Crime figures for LS20 are sourced from the Police.uk open data platform and weighted against ONS 2021 Census population estimates to produce comparable per-resident rates. Data is updated monthly, typically 1–2 months after the end of each reporting period.
